Akashi is perhaps the most formidable antagonist in the series. His "Emperor Eye" allows him to see the future movements of his opponents, rendering him virtually unstoppable. Throughout the season, the question wasn't just "Can Seirin win?" but "Is it even possible to score against Akashi?" The tension leading into Episode 24 is suffocating.
